配置文件参考
1. 引言
在使用Haskell和Yesod开发Web应用的过程中,配置文件扮演着至关重要的角色。这些文件不仅决定了应用的行为,还影响着开发、测试和生产环境的具体表现。本文将详细介绍与Yesod应用相关的各类配置文件,包括项目构建配置、应用配置、数据库配置、环境变量配置以及部署配置。通过本文,读者将掌握如何正确设置和调整这些配置文件,以确保应用在不同环境下都能稳定运行。
2. 项目构建配置
2.1 .cabal 文件
.cabal 文件是Haskell项目的基础配置文件,它定义了项目的依赖关系、构建选项和其他元数据。一个典型的 .cabal 文件如下所示:
name: my-yesod-app
version: 0.1.0.0
synopsis: A simple Yesod application
description: This is a simple Yesod application for demonstration purposes.
homepage: https://github.com/username/my-yesod-app
license: BSD3
author: Your Name
maintainer: your.email@example.com
copyright:
超级会员免费看
订阅专栏 解锁全文
7987

被折叠的 条评论
为什么被折叠?



